The seats still in play in Queensland as we say goodnight

 

So we’re on the verge of wrapping this exercise up for the night. At time of print, 54 per cent of the vote has been counted.

 

Antony Green says the Labor votes “continue to sort of drift up through the night” and that pre-polling did not disadvantage the incumbent Premier. Labor’s overall vote is up 4.2 per cent, while One Nation was the biggest loser of the night, down 6.1 per cent.

 

So now to the seats still in doubt. The ABC believes Labor has won Caloundra and Pumicestone from the LNP on the Sunshine Coast, while they have lost Jackie Trad’s seat of South Brisbane to the Greens.
